LITERATURE REVIEW
Concept of training, recruitment and selection
As per the thought of Crane and Matten, (2016), it has been said that training refers to the
process where managers enhance the performance as well as efficiency of employees by
providing them guidance. It is one of the most effective method through which management
team of the organisation provide various growth opportunities through which they can growth at
both personal as well as professional level. In case of selection and recruitment process,
managers hire best and suitable candidate for their organisation so that they can accomplish their
goals and objectives effectively. In addition to this, it is also very essential to provide training
sessions on a regular basis so that they can easily adapt changing environment while they meet
their requirements at international marketplace.
Study of Training, Selection and Recruitment Methods of MNCs - Nestle Case Study_4
Different training, recruitment and selection methods adopted by Nestle to fulfil their
requirements
According to the view point of Huntington, (2018) , it has been identified that
organisational performance is mainly depends on the effectiveness of employees as both is inter
related with each other. It is very essential to have effective employees within organisation so
that they can attain organisational goals and objectives within stipulated time frame. Apart from
this, it has been said that management team use different methods in order to select, hire, recruit
and appoint skilled candidates for the organisation. Some of these method includes online
recruitment, campus placement, internal recruitment and many more. Candidates who are
interested in the job profile can send their resume through emails and grab different
opportunities.
Various issues faced by managers of Nestle while given them training sessions to the
employees to fulfil their international requirements
According to the thought of Dutta and Bose, (2015), it has identified that there are
ample number of issues which is faced by management team of organisation while they
provide training to their staff members in order to meet their international requirements. It is
very important for the management team to provide training and development sessions on a
regular basis so that they can gain various opportunities for their future development. But
there are some issues which affects the whole method of providing training. It includes
different perception of individuals, technological barriers, environmental differences and so
on. These barriers might affect the performance and effectiveness of business organisation.
P2 Project management plan
PMP is basically a written document which is confidential. It is a kind of blueprint of
what all activities will be undertaken during a year. It consists of different strategies which will
be used to execute project. This type of document is very helpful in building a project as it helps
other teammates to know what work has to be done and in what manner (Crane and Matten,
2016). In this investigation, researcher has made project management plan so that there is
efficiency in executing it. Important elements of this Project management plan is listed below:
Scope: This research has a wide scope. As industry will get a new direction with the
help of this plan. Apart from the scope there are some limitations of this research which
need to be consider by the investigator, it includes limited amount of money and time
Study of Training, Selection and Recruitment Methods of MNCs - Nestle Case Study_5
which affect the whole result of the research. Every project has a particular scope which
is basically reason behind existence of that project. Researcher defines scope of every
project before starting of that project. With the assistance of research scope, investigator
will be able to know about the effectiveness of present research topic. Along with this,
scope of the research is very wide which provide various opportunities to the
organisation in order to expand their business functions at international marketplace.
Cost: Financial resource is very important for every project. Without it no activity can
be successfully executed. Different types of costs are involved in every project with the
help of which researcher will be able to conduct the present investigation in an effective
manner. Such as cost for operations, cost involved for other resources these all have to
be calculated before starting of project. So that sources from where such funds can be
arranged are also determined. In the present report, overall cost of the research is
£40,000 in order to conduct the research in an effective manner. Apart from this,
£60,000 requires by the company in order to adopt all the recommendations in an
effective manner. If the overall cost of the research will be increase it will affect the
outcome of the research in a negative manner. Therefore, in order to monitor the budget
in an effective manner there must be use of appropriate tools and techniques.

P3 Gantt chart and WBS.
Gantt chart
A Gantt chart is similar to a bar chart it is basically used determine schedule of project.
Different tasks to be performed are listed on vertical axis and time is mentioned on horizontal
axis. Status of project is depicted by Gantt chart. It basically provides information related to
various activities of project.
